D.3.1 Layout of the `sysdeps' Directory Hierarchy
|
||
-------------------------------------------------
|
||
|
||
A GNU configuration name has three parts: the CPU type, the
|
||
manufacturer's name, and the operating system. `configure' uses these
|
||
to pick the list of system-dependent directories to look for. If the
|
||
`--nfp' option is _not_ passed to `configure', the directory
|
||
`MACHINE/fpu' is also used. The operating system often has a "base
|
||
operating system"; for example, if the operating system is `Linux', the
|
||
base operating system is `unix/sysv'. The algorithm used to pick the
|
||
list of directories is simple: `configure' makes a list of the base
|
||
operating system, manufacturer, CPU type, and operating system, in that
|
||
order. It then concatenates all these together with slashes in
|
||
between, to produce a directory name; for example, the configuration
|
||
`i686-linux-gnu' results in `unix/sysv/linux/i386/i686'. `configure'
|
||
then tries removing each element of the list in turn, so
|
||
`unix/sysv/linux' and `unix/sysv' are also tried, among others. Since
|
||
the precise version number of the operating system is often not
|
||
important, and it would be very inconvenient, for example, to have
|
||
identical `irix6.2' and `irix6.3' directories, `configure' tries
|
||
successively less specific operating system names by removing trailing
|
||
suffixes starting with a period.
|
||
|
||
As an example, here is the complete list of directories that would be
|
||
tried for the configuration `i686-linux-gnu':
|
||
|
||
sysdeps/i386/elf
|
||
sysdeps/unix/sysv/linux/i386
|
||
sysdeps/unix/sysv/linux
|
||
sysdeps/gnu
|
||
sysdeps/unix/common
|
||
sysdeps/unix/mman
|
||
sysdeps/unix/inet
|
||
sysdeps/unix/sysv/i386/i686
|
||
sysdeps/unix/sysv/i386
|
||
sysdeps/unix/sysv
|
||
sysdeps/unix/i386
|
||
sysdeps/unix
|
||
sysdeps/posix
|
||
sysdeps/i386/i686
|
||
sysdeps/i386/i486
|
||
sysdeps/libm-i387/i686
|
||
sysdeps/i386/fpu
|
||
sysdeps/libm-i387
|
||
sysdeps/i386
|
||
sysdeps/wordsize-32
|
||
sysdeps/ieee754
|
||
sysdeps/libm-ieee754
|
||
sysdeps/generic
|
||
|
||
Different machine architectures are conventionally subdirectories at
|
||
the top level of the `sysdeps' directory tree. For example,
|
||
`sysdeps/sparc' and `sysdeps/m68k'. These contain files specific to
|
||
those machine architectures, but not specific to any particular
|
||
operating system. There might be subdirectories for specializations of
|
||
those architectures, such as `sysdeps/m68k/68020'. Code which is
|
||
specific to the floating-point coprocessor used with a particular
|
||
machine should go in `sysdeps/MACHINE/fpu'.
|
||
|
||
There are a few directories at the top level of the `sysdeps'
|
||
hierarchy that are not for particular machine architectures.
|
||
|
||
`generic'
|
||
As described above (*note Porting::), this is the subdirectory
|
||
that every configuration implicitly uses after all others.
|
||
|
||
`ieee754'
|
||
This directory is for code using the IEEE 754 floating-point
|
||
format, where the C type `float' is IEEE 754 single-precision
|
||
format, and `double' is IEEE 754 double-precision format. Usually
|
||
this directory is referred to in the `Implies' file in a machine
|
||
architecture-specific directory, such as `m68k/Implies'.
|
||
|
||
`libm-ieee754'
|
||
This directory contains an implementation of a mathematical library
|
||
usable on platforms which use IEEE 754 conformant floating-point
|
||
arithmetic.
|
||
|
||
`libm-i387'
|
||
This is a special case. Ideally the code should be in
|
||
`sysdeps/i386/fpu' but for various reasons it is kept aside.
|
||
|
||
`posix'
|
||
This directory contains implementations of things in the library in
|
||
terms of POSIX.1 functions. This includes some of the POSIX.1
|
||
functions themselves. Of course, POSIX.1 cannot be completely
|
||
implemented in terms of itself, so a configuration using just
|
||
`posix' cannot be complete.
|
||
|
||
`unix'
|
||
This is the directory for Unix-like things. *Note Porting to
|
||
Unix::. `unix' implies `posix'. There are some special-purpose
|
||
subdirectories of `unix':
|
||
|
||
`unix/common'
|
||
This directory is for things common to both BSD and System V
|
||
release 4. Both `unix/bsd' and `unix/sysv/sysv4' imply
|
||
`unix/common'.
|
||
|
||
`unix/inet'
|
||
This directory is for `socket' and related functions on Unix
|
||
systems. `unix/inet/Subdirs' enables the `inet' top-level
|
||
subdirectory. `unix/common' implies `unix/inet'.
|
||
|
||
`mach'
|
||
This is the directory for things based on the Mach microkernel
|
||
from CMU (including GNU/Hurd systems). Other basic operating
|
||
systems (VMS, for example) would have their own directories at the
|
||
top level of the `sysdeps' hierarchy, parallel to `unix' and
|
||
`mach'.

D.3.2 Porting the GNU C Library to Unix Systems
|
||
-----------------------------------------------
|
||
|
||
Most Unix systems are fundamentally very similar. There are variations
|
||
between different machines, and variations in what facilities are
|
||
provided by the kernel. But the interface to the operating system
|
||
facilities is, for the most part, pretty uniform and simple.
|
||
|
||
The code for Unix systems is in the directory `unix', at the top
|
||
level of the `sysdeps' hierarchy. This directory contains
|
||
subdirectories (and subdirectory trees) for various Unix variants.
|
||
|
||
The functions which are system calls in most Unix systems are
|
||
implemented in assembly code, which is generated automatically from
|
||
specifications in files named `syscalls.list'. There are several such
|
||
files, one in `sysdeps/unix' and others in its subdirectories. Some
|
||
special system calls are implemented in files that are named with a
|
||
suffix of `.S'; for example, `_exit.S'. Files ending in `.S' are run
|
||
through the C preprocessor before being fed to the assembler.
|
||
|
||
These files all use a set of macros that should be defined in
|
||
`sysdep.h'. The `sysdep.h' file in `sysdeps/unix' partially defines
|
||
them; a `sysdep.h' file in another directory must finish defining them
|
||
for the particular machine and operating system variant. See
|
||
`sysdeps/unix/sysdep.h' and the machine-specific `sysdep.h'
|
||
implementations to see what these macros are and what they should do.
|
||
|
||
The system-specific makefile for the `unix' directory
|
||
(`sysdeps/unix/Makefile') gives rules to generate several files from
|
||
the Unix system you are building the library on (which is assumed to be
|
||
the target system you are building the library _for_). All the
|
||
generated files are put in the directory where the object files are
|
||
kept; they should not affect the source tree itself. The files
|
||
generated are `ioctls.h', `errnos.h', `sys/param.h', and `errlist.c'
|
||
(for the `stdio' section of the library).

E.1 PowerPC-specific Facilities
|
||
===============================
|
||
|
||
Facilities specific to PowerPC that are not specific to a particular
|
||
operating system are declared in `sys/platform/ppc.h'.
|
||
|
||
-- Function: uint64_t __ppc_get_timebase (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Read the current value of the Time Base Register.
|
||
|
||
The "Time Base Register" is a 64-bit register that stores a
|
||
monotonically incremented value updated at a system-dependent
|
||
frequency that may be different from the processor frequency.
|
||
More information is available in `Power ISA 2.06b - Book II -
|
||
Section 5.2'.
|
||
|
||
`__ppc_get_timebase' uses the processor's time base facility
|
||
directly without requiring assistance from the operating system,
|
||
so it is very efficient.
|
||
|
||
-- Function: uint64_t __ppc_get_timebase_freq (void)
|
||
Preliminary: | MT-Unsafe init | AS-Unsafe corrupt:init | AC-Unsafe
|
||
corrupt:init | *Note POSIX Safety Concepts::.
|
||
|
||
Read the current frequency at which the Time Base Register is
|
||
updated.
|
||
|
||
This frequency is not related to the processor clock or the bus
|
||
clock. It is also possible that this frequency is not constant.
|
||
More information is available in `Power ISA 2.06b - Book II -
|
||
Section 5.2'.
|
||
|
||
The following functions provide hints about the usage of resources
|
||
that are shared with other processors. They can be used, for example,
|
||
if a program waiting on a lock intends to divert the shared resources
|
||
to be used by other processors. More information is available in
|
||
`Power ISA 2.06b - Book II - Section 3.2'.
|
||
|
||
-- Function: void __ppc_yield (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Provide a hint that performance will probably be improved if
|
||
shared resources dedicated to the executing processor are released
|
||
for use by other processors.
|
||
|
||
-- Function: void __ppc_mdoio (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Provide a hint that performance will probably be improved if
|
||
shared resources dedicated to the executing processor are released
|
||
until all outstanding storage accesses to caching-inhibited
|
||
storage have been completed.
|
||
|
||
-- Function: void __ppc_mdoom (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Provide a hint that performance will probably be improved if
|
||
shared resources dedicated to the executing processor are released
|
||
until all outstanding storage accesses to cacheable storage for
|
||
which the data is not in the cache have been completed.
|
||
|
||
-- Function: void __ppc_set_ppr_med (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Set the Program Priority Register to medium value (default).
|
||
|
||
The "Program Priority Register" (PPR) is a 64-bit register that
|
||
controls the program's priority. By adjusting the PPR value the
|
||
programmer may improve system throughput by causing the system
|
||
resources to be used more efficiently, especially in contention
|
||
situations. The three unprivileged states available are covered
|
||
by the functions `__ppc_set_ppr_med' (medium - default),
|
||
`__ppc_set_ppc_low' (low) and `__ppc_set_ppc_med_low' (medium
|
||
low). More information available in `Power ISA 2.06b - Book II -
|
||
Section 3.1'.
|
||
|
||
-- Function: void __ppc_set_ppr_low (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Set the Program Priority Register to low value.
|
||
|
||
-- Function: void __ppc_set_ppr_med_low (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Set the Program Priority Register to medium low value.
|
||
|
||
Power ISA 2.07 extends the priorities that can be set to the Program
|
||
Priority Register (PPR). The following functions implement the new
|
||
priority levels: very low and medium high.
|
||
|
||
-- Function: void __ppc_set_ppr_very_low (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Set the Program Priority Register to very low value.
|
||
|
||
-- Function: void __ppc_set_ppr_med_high (void)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Set the Program Priority Register to medium high value. The
|
||
medium high priority is privileged and may only be set during
|
||
certain time intervals by problem-state programs. If the program
|
||
priority is medium high when the time interval expires or if an
|
||
attempt is made to set the priority to medium high when it is not
|
||
allowed, the priority is set to medium.

E.2 RISC-V-specific Facilities
|
||
==============================
|
||
|
||
Cache management facilities specific to RISC-V systems that implement
|
||
the Linux ABI are declared in `sys/cachectl.h'.
|
||
|
||
-- Function: void __riscv_flush_icache (void *START, void *END,
|
||
unsigned long int FLAGS)
|
||
Preliminary: | MT-Safe | AS-Safe | AC-Safe | *Note POSIX Safety
|
||
Concepts::.
|
||
|
||
Enforce ordering between stores and instruction cache fetches.
|
||
The range of addresses over which ordering is enforced is
|
||
specified by START and END. The FLAGS argument controls the
|
||
extent of this ordering, with the default behavior (a FLAGS value
|
||
of 0) being to enforce the fence on all threads in the current
|
||
process. Setting the `SYS_RISCV_FLUSH_ICACHE_LOCAL' bit allows
|
||
users to indicate that enforcing ordering on only the current
|
||
thread is necessary. All other flag bits are reserved.

Appendix G Free Software Needs Free Documentation
|
||
*************************************************
|
||
|
||
The biggest deficiency in the free software community today is not in
|
||
the software--it is the lack of good free documentation that we can
|
||
include with the free software. Many of our most important programs do
|
||
not come with free reference manuals and free introductory texts.
|
||
Documentation is an essential part of any software package; when an
|
||
important free software package does not come with a free manual and a
|
||
free tutorial, that is a major gap. We have many such gaps today.
|
||
|
||
Consider Perl, for instance. The tutorial manuals that people
|
||
normally use are non-free. How did this come about? Because the
|
||
authors of those manuals published them with restrictive terms--no
|
||
copying, no modification, source files not available--which exclude
|
||
them from the free software world.
|
||
|
||
That wasn't the first time this sort of thing happened, and it was
|
||
far from the last. Many times we have heard a GNU user eagerly
|
||
describe a manual that he is writing, his intended contribution to the
|
||
community, only to learn that he had ruined everything by signing a
|
||
publication contract to make it non-free.
|
||
|
||
Free documentation, like free software, is a matter of freedom, not
|
||
price. The problem with the non-free manual is not that publishers
|
||
charge a price for printed copies--that in itself is fine. (The Free
|
||
Software Foundation sells printed copies of manuals, too.) The problem
|
||
is the restrictions on the use of the manual. Free manuals are
|
||
available in source code form, and give you permission to copy and
|
||
modify. Non-free manuals do not allow this.
|
||
|
||
The criteria of freedom for a free manual are roughly the same as for
|
||
free software. Redistribution (including the normal kinds of
|
||
commercial redistribution) must be permitted, so that the manual can
|
||
accompany every copy of the program, both on-line and on paper.
|
||
|
||
Permission for modification of the technical content is crucial too.
|
||
When people modify the software, adding or changing features, if they
|
||
are conscientious they will change the manual too--so they can provide
|
||
accurate and clear documentation for the modified program. A manual
|
||
that leaves you no choice but to write a new manual to document a
|
||
changed version of the program is not really available to our community.
|
||
|
||
Some kinds of limits on the way modification is handled are
|
||
acceptable. For example, requirements to preserve the original
|
||
author's copyright notice, the distribution terms, or the list of
|
||
authors, are ok. It is also no problem to require modified versions to
|
||
include notice that they were modified. Even entire sections that may
|
||
not be deleted or changed are acceptable, as long as they deal with
|
||
nontechnical topics (like this one). These kinds of restrictions are
|
||
acceptable because they don't obstruct the community's normal use of
|
||
the manual.
|
||
|
||
However, it must be possible to modify all the _technical_ content
|
||
of the manual, and then distribute the result in all the usual media,
|
||
through all the usual channels. Otherwise, the restrictions obstruct
|
||
the use of the manual, it is not free, and we need another manual to
|
||
replace it.
|
||
|
||
Please spread the word about this issue. Our community continues to
|
||
lose manuals to proprietary publishing. If we spread the word that
|
||
free software needs free reference manuals and free tutorials, perhaps
|
||
the next person who wants to contribute by writing documentation will
|
||
realize, before it is too late, that only free manuals contribute to
|
||
the free software community.
|
||
|
||
If you are writing documentation, please insist on publishing it
|
||
under the GNU Free Documentation License or another free documentation
|
||
license. Remember that this decision requires your approval--you don't
|
||
have to let the publisher decide. Some commercial publishers will use
|
||
a free license if you insist, but they will not propose the option; it
|
||
is up to you to raise the issue and say firmly that this is what you
|
||
want. If the publisher you are dealing with refuses, please try other
|
||
publishers. If you're not sure whether a proposed license is free,
|
||
write to <licensing@gnu.org>.
|
||
|
||
You can encourage commercial publishers to sell more free, copylefted
|
||
manuals and tutorials by buying them, and particularly by buying copies
|
||
from the publishers that paid for their writing or for major
|
||
improvements. Meanwhile, try to avoid buying non-free documentation at
|
||
all. Check the distribution terms of a manual before you buy it, and
|
||
insist that whoever seeks your business must respect your freedom.
|
||
Check the history of the book, and try reward the publishers that have
|
||
paid or pay the authors to work on it.
|
||
|
||
The Free Software Foundation maintains a list of free documentation
|
||
published by other publishers, at
|
||
`http://www.fsf.org/doc/other-free-books.html'.
